Why Zimbabwe Needs Mobile Energy Solutions
With 18-24 hours of daily load-shedding in some regions (ZESA 2023 report), traditional grid power can't meet Zimbabwe's growing energy demands. Mining operations lose $8,500/hour during outages, while hospitals risk patient safety. That's where mobile BESS units become game-changers.
Key Challenges in Zimbabwe's Power Sector
- 47% electricity generation deficit during dry seasons
- Aging infrastructure needing $2.1 billion in upgrades
- 46% of rural businesses using expensive diesel generators
How Power Supply Vehicles Work
Think of these uninterruptible power supply vehicles as mobile power stations. A standard unit contains:
| Component | Function | Capacity Range |
|---|---|---|
| Lithium-ion Batteries | Energy storage | 100kWh - 2MWh |
| Inverter System | DC to AC conversion | 50kW - 500kW |
| Solar Integration | Renewable charging | Up to 200kWp |

Real-World Applications
1. Emergency Power for Healthcare
When Cyclone Ana knocked out power for 72 hours, a Bulawayo hospital used BESS vehicles to:
- Maintain ICU equipment operation
- Keep vaccines refrigerated
- Power emergency lighting systems
2. Agricultural Support
A Mashonaland farming cooperative achieved:
- 24/7 irrigation pumping
- 50% reduction in energy costs
- Solar-charged operation during daylight

Implementation Considerations
When planning your mobile BESS deployment:
- Calculate your peak and average load requirements
- Assess site accessibility for vehicle positioning
- Evaluate charging options (solar/grid/generator)
